Simple QR码扫描与生成器:开源项目实战指南
项目介绍
Simple QR 是一个开源的应用程序,专注于提供简单直观的界面来扫描、创建并存储二维码。该应用以高效、无后台服务、不收集数据以及无广告而自豪。它支持多种语言,包括英语、法语、德语、意大利语、巴西葡萄牙语、俄语、繁体和简体中文等。项目基于开放源代码,详情可访问其在 GitHub 的主页。这不仅保障了用户的隐私,也为开发者社区提供了学习与贡献的机会。
项目快速启动
要开始使用或贡献于 Simple QR
开源项目,请遵循以下步骤:
克隆项目
首先,你需要从 GitHub 上克隆这个项目到你的本地环境:
git clone https://github.com/tomfong/simple-qr.git
cd simple-qr
环境搭建(针对开发者)
确保你已经安装了适当的开发环境,如 Android Studio 或用于构建 Android 应用的必要工具链。对于查看或修改后端逻辑,如果你是 PHP 开发者并且对 Laravel 框架感兴趣,可以参考相关依赖进行设置。
运行应用(示例)
请注意,下面的步骤更多适用于前端Android应用的开发者环境配置,具体后端如果是PHP相关的,将涉及到Laravel框架的设置,但此处主要关注App本身:
- 对于Android项目,打开
.android
目录下的相应文件(假设你使用Android Studio)。 - 安装必要的依赖,并同步Gradle。
- 运行应用至模拟器或真实设备。
对于想在Laravel环境中使用二维码生成功能的部分,需参照SimpleSoftwareIO/simple-qrcode
仓库了解如何集成到Laravel项目中去。
应用案例和最佳实践
- 票务系统: 利用Simple QR快速生成独一无二的入场券二维码,通过手机即可轻松验证。
- 库存管理: 在商品标签上打印二维码,便于快速扫码入库、出库,提高效率。
- 社交媒体链接分享: 用户可以通过生成含有个人社交平台链接的二维码,简化分享流程。
- 最佳实践: 在实现任何案例时,重视用户隐私,避免在二维码中嵌入敏感信息,并确保应用程序运行的流畅性及用户体验。
典型生态项目
SimpleSoftwareIO/simple-qrcode
是与 Laravel 框架紧密结合的一个PHP库,属于此生态系统中的一个重要组件。它使得在 Laravel 应用中生成二维码变得异常简单,常见应用场景包括但不限于会员注册确认、电子票据下载链接、网站分享链接的二维码化等。通过这样的库,开发者能够快速地在他们的Web应用中整合二维码功能,增强交互性和便利性。
以上是对 Simple QR
开源项目的简要介绍及其在不同场景下的应用概述。对于具体的编码实践,建议详细阅读各项目的官方文档和技术论坛,以便更深入地理解和使用这些强大且灵活的工具。